Doucette, Jr. 256 I I I I I I I I I I I I I I I I I I ARCADIS GERAGHTY&MILLER With respect to monitoring the discharge in the event that the City approves our request, we suggest that the follov.ing sampling program is more than adequate: • Weekly sampling during the first month, and • Monthly sampling thereafter. The City should consider that groundwater quality, unlike many industrial process discharges, is not prone to vary greatly over a short time. Many industrial pretreatment processes will involve batch technologies where each batch could be different and/or a mistake such as opening a valve early "ill result in very different and poss.ibly harmful water quality on a daily basis .. The groundwater treatment system as installed at the subject site has safeguards to shut the system dm,11 in the event that the treatment system fails. Our expected daily load of total cyanide and chlorinated aliphatics, the site contaminants, is within the permissible limits. Groundwater beneath JFD Electronics/Channel Master Site is contaminated ·With volatile organic compounds. Currently, this Site is undergoing groundwater remediation under the direction of U, S, Environmenta_l Protection Agency. Groundwater is extracted through a set of recovery w_ells for treatment using an airstripper, The treated effluent is proposed to be List the primary products produced at this facility: be discharged to the sanitary sewer on-site.
